My research is in the area of statistical genetics, and it contains three projects: (1) Differentiating the Cochran-Armitage (CA) trend test and Pearson’s chi-square test: location and dispersion; (2) Decomposing Pearson’s chi-square test: a linear regression and its departure from linearity; (3) Testing nonlinear gene-environment (GxE) interaction through varying coefficient and linear mixed models.

Ranked set sampling (RSS) is an efficient data collection framework compared to simple random sampling (SRS). It is widely used in various application areas such as agriculture, environment, sociology, and medicine, especially in situations where measurement is expensive but ranking is less costly. Most past research in RSS focused on situations where the underlying distribution is continuous. However, it is not unusual to have a discrete data generation mechanism. Estimating statistical functionals are challenging as ties may truly exist in discrete RSS. In this thesis, we started with estimating the cumulative distribution function (CDF) in discrete RSS. This research contains two topics: (1) PBNPA: a permutation-based non-parametric analysis of CRISPR screen data; (2) RCRnorm: an integrated system of random-coefficient hierarchical regression models for normalizing NanoString nCounter data from FFPE samples.

Clustered regularly-interspaced short palindromic repeats (CRISPR) screens are usually implemented in cultured cells to identify genes with critical functions. Although several methods have been developed or adapted to analyze CRISPR screening data, no single spe- cific algorithm has gained popularity. Thus, rigorous procedures are needed to overcome the shortcomings of existing algorithms.
